WebIn the event you are denied, do not become upset. This is common and often a “first response” by many insurance providers. Unfortunately, many individuals face this challenge when getting approved for weight-loss surgery. However, it is important to know that you can appeal this decision and let your voice be heard. Institutes of Quality ® for Bariatric, Cardiac, and Orthopedic. think tank in washington dcWebApproval for bariatric surgery depends on showing that the procedure is medically necessary. Getting insurance coverage for the surgery is more likely if your doctor can verify that you have certain co-morbidities, which are medical issues due to your weight. think tank institute for the study of war
